As a Personnel Logistics Coordinator with TAC Healthcare, you will be a focal point for all day to day operational and resourcing related activity and queries, liaising with our clients, medics, clinicians and account managers, regarding ongoing and locum business requirements.
This is a full-time permanent position, working from our office in Dyce, and you will be required to participate in an on-call rota.
As part of the Offshore Team, you will build and maintain talent pools of Offshore Medics, so if you’re looking for a fast paced and varied career opportunity, then this could be a great move for you!
What You Will Do
- Identify skilled and qualified candidates for critical business roles.
- Proactively build and develop pools of candidates with necessary skills and qualification to fill business critical roles. This involves maintaining regular contact, accurate availability information, and ensuring a record of all certifications, qualifications and accreditation.
- Maintain records of training, certifications, qualifications, accreditation, Right to Work and project ready CVs.
- Planning of rotas and assignments.
- Proactively schedule and deliver inductions to personnel within talent pools, ensuring inductions are fit for purpose and continually improved.
- Work closely with other business stakeholders to ensure successful onboarding of new colleagues e.g., Onboarding, HR, IT.
